If you suffer from a serious back injury, such as a ruptured disc, you can experience the most comfort by laying on your back, with it flat, while you also bend your knees. The relieves any tension in your tendons and muscles that run down your back and through your legs.

Some fitness regimens are very effective at reducing back injuries and the pain associated with them. For example, yoga increases your flexibility, which can help prevent straining any muscles. Another great source of exercise for reducing back discomfort is Pilates. This program strengthens your core, which can help your stomach muscles to support your back.

Do not let your back pain stress you out; this only makes the pain worse. Instead, discover ways to relax so there is less chance you will experience spasms in your back muscles. Make sure that you get enough rest, and place heat onto your back in order to soothe any pain you’re experiencing.
If you are experiencing back pain caused by spasms, you should try to calm them to get relief. The best way to accomplish this is to just lay down and place a heating pad on the aching muscles. You can also drink many fluids and reduce your sodium until the pain goes away. Dehydration can cause even worse muscle spasms.
Don’t forget to do the simple things when suffering from back discomfort. It’s often helpful to just rest for a couple of days. Take ibuprofen, acetaminophen, or any other anti-inflammatory medicine to ease your back discomfort while you are resting. You can soothe the pain by alternating cold and hot treatments.

It may seem illogical, but those who have back pain need to exercise regularly. People that suffer from back pain often think that exercise can make their back pain more unbearable, but it helps! Stretching back muscles and moving them around increases circulation and reduces tightness and pain.
